Cellebrite Mobile Forensics Fundamentals (CMFF) is a two (2) day entry level course designed to provide attendees with compulsory digital forensics fundamental knowledge including: mobile device communication networks, explorations of Android and iOS file systems, extraction methodologies. memory (NAND) functions, and the proper handling of digital evidence for use in administrative, civil, or criminal actions. Attendees will learn the reasoning and strategies used by creditable practitioners and organisations to form the future of digital forensic best practices.
